How much does a Patient Care Coordinator make?

The average salary for a Patient Care Coordinator is $43,666 per year in the US.

A Patient Care Coordinator plays a vital role in the healthcare industry. They help ensure patients receive the care they need. The average yearly salary for this position is $43,666. This salary can change based on experience and location. Those with more experience often earn higher wages.

Patient Care Coordinators work in various settings, including hospitals, clinics, and private practices. Their duties may include managing patient appointments, coordinating treatment plans, and communicating with healthcare providers. The salary data shows that these professionals can earn anywhere from $30,800 to $92,850 annually. Most coordinators fall in the middle range of this salary spectrum. This range shows that dedication and experience can lead to better pay.

What are the highest paying cities for a Patient Care Coordinator?

Patient Care Coordinators earn the highest salaries in San Francisco, California, and San Jose, California. These cities provide top-tier compensation packages for those in the role. This suggests a strong demand for patient care coordination in these urban areas.
Graph displaying highest paying cities salaries for Patient Care Coordinator jobs, highlighting San Francisco, CA with the highest at $77,885 and Indianapolis, IN with the lowest at $58,639.
  1. San Francisco, CA
    Average Salary: $77,885

What are the best companies a Patient Care Coordinator can work for?

Job seekers looking for Patient Care Coordinator roles will find attractive opportunities with top-paying companies. NewYork-Presbyterian Hospital leads the way with an average salary of $167,500. Montefiore Medical and Kaiser Permanente also offer competitive wages, with averages of $134,316 and $132,432 respectively. These top employers provide promising career growth and financial rewards.
Graph displaying best paying company salaries for Patient Care Coordinator jobs, highlighting NewYork-Presbyterian Hospital with the highest at $167,500 and Methodist Le Bonheur Healthcare with the lowest at $77,267.

How to earn more as a Patient Care Coordinator?

Increasing your earning potential as a Patient Care Coordinator can lead to a rewarding career and financial stability. This role involves managing patient care and ensuring smooth operations within healthcare facilities. Several strategies can help improve earnings in this field.

First, gaining additional certifications can enhance job prospects and salary. Certifications such as Certified Patient Care Technician (CPCT) or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) can demonstrate expertise and dedication. These credentials make candidates more attractive to employers and can lead to higher pay.

Second, acquiring experience in different healthcare settings can broaden skill sets and increase market value. Working in various environments such as hospitals, clinics, and private practices provides a well-rounded experience that employers value. Experience in multiple settings can make a candidate more versatile and capable of handling diverse tasks.

Additionally, improving communication and organizational skills can boost job performance and open up higher-paying opportunities. Effective communication ensures patients receive the best care, while strong organizational skills help manage patient schedules and medical records efficiently. These skills are crucial for success in a Patient Care Coordinator role.
